This time I want to talk about taking people seriously, because, in fact, most people do.<\/p>\n<p>Sometimes, we take people too seriously.   We allow the nasty comment of a stranger ruin our day.  We allow the unfeeling statement of a friend or acquaintance to hurt us.<\/p>\n<p>My mother used to say, &#8220;consider the source,&#8221; meaning that if the person said something nasty or cruel, chances are he\/she wasn&#8217;t such a nice person to begin with.<\/p>\n<p>On the other hand, we should pay attention to those who are kind and helpful and to people who we can trust.  <\/p>\n<p>Many years ago, my dear friend Susan said only a few words to me that changed (for the better, of course) my whole life.  From time to time, I run into people I have had as clients and other acquaintances and they tell me that something that I had told them in the past really helped them.<\/p>\n<p>In Pirke Avot, wise people are instructed to be careful with their words&#8211; and even those of us who are not wise, should be careful.  Words can hurt and words can heal. <\/p>\n<p>And here is the real challenge that we live with: people listen when we speak.  When we say something that helps or hurts them, t<strong>hey remember what we&#8217;ve said far longer than we do<\/strong>.  A word said in anger can ruin a relationship.  A kind word can save a life.<\/p>\n<p>So maybe when we&#8217;re thinking of cleaning for Passover, when we rid ourselves of even the tiniest crumbs of what is unfit, it&#8217;s a good time to think of the impact of what we say and to realize that even the smallest negative remark can hurt someone a very long time and the smallest expression of support can change someone&#8217;s life.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Last time I wrote a serious post, it was about not taking what people say seriously when they are not being rational (throwing a tantrum).
